6.4% of the total supply (64,300,000 ITHACA) is unlocked at TGE, with the tokens split between Foundation, Public Sale, Community, and Investors.
Ithaca Protocol has a total supply of 1,000,000,000 ITHACA, of which 546,388,889 ITHACA (54.6% of total) is currently circulating.
Total length of the full Ithaca Protocol emission schedule is 3 years, with 33.74% released in Year 1, while the remaining 66.26% is released over the following 2 years.

Ithaca Protocol introduces a cutting-edge solution to modern DeFi needs with its non-custodial, composable option protocol, designed to enhance risk-sharing capabilities across interconnected blockchain ecosystems. At its core, the protocol aims to facilitate permissionless cross-chain infrastructure focusing on liquidity optimization, composability, and transparency. A standout feature is its **Option Trading Protocol**, which allows users to create and trade options seamlessly across multiple chains, unlocking new strategies for risk management in decentralized finance markets. This is supported by an **Algorithmic Market Maker (AMM)** that delivers robust liquidity provision for decentralized options trading, ensuring efficiency and fairness in pricing. Through its **Collateral Optimization Engine**, Ithaca provides a framework for maximizing asset utilization and supporting dynamic collateral requirements, accelerating innovation in lending and trading environments. Looking ahead, Ithaca Protocol is evolving to include advanced functionalities such as a **margin lending and liquidation mechanism**, enabling participants to borrow or trade on margin securely. Furthermore, decentralized governance ensures that community stakeholders retain control over protocol updates and fee structures, fostering a truly autonomous financial ecosystem. Built for seamless interoperability, Ithaca collaborates with leading protocols like **Axelar** to deliver cross-chain operability. This ensures assets and data can flow seamlessly across multiple blockchains, creating an ecosystem where composability is key. With its focus on optimizing liquidity pools and advancing risk diversification, Ithaca positions itself as a leading infrastructure provider for the next generation of DeFi innovation. The tokenomics of Ithaca Protocol are underpinned by its native utility token, **$ITHACA**, which governs incentives across the ecosystem. $ITHACA enables seamless staking, fee reductions, governance voting, and collateral requirements within the network, ensuring its ongoing decentralization and efficiency.
